Common Issues and How to Identify Them

Most problems with the KBLN165H fall into three broad categories: power irregularities, signal distortion, and mechanical wear. Spotting the right symptom is half the battle.

  • Power fluctuations – The unit powers on intermittently, or the indicator lights flicker.
  • Signal loss or noise – Audio or data output becomes garbled, with static or dropouts.
  • Mechanical stutter – Moving parts (such as a motorized slider) jerk or stall unexpectedly.

Before you open the case, make a quick checklist: verify the power cable, test the outlet with a multimeter, and listen for unusual sounds. These simple steps often reveal the root cause without deeper disassembly.

Step-by-Step Troubleshooting Process

1. Isolate the Power Supply

Start by unplugging the KBLN165H and inspecting the power brick for swollen capacitors or burnt marks. If you have a spare, swap it in; a healthy supply usually restores functionality within minutes. If the problem persists, move on to the internal fuse.

2. Test Internal Fuses and Voltage Rails

Using a calibrated multimeter, check each fuse for continuity. Replace any that read open. Next, probe the main voltage rails (typically 5 V, 12 V, and 24 V) while the unit is powered. Values that deviate more than 5 % from the spec suggest a failing regulator.

3. Examine Signal Pathways

Signal issues often stem from loose connectors or corroded contacts. Gently reseat all ribbon cables and coaxial connectors. For stubborn corrosion, a light brush with isopropyl alcohol can restore conductivity. After reseating, run a test tone or data packet to confirm clean transmission.

4. Diagnose Mechanical Components

If a motorized component stalls, listen for a humming sound that indicates power but no motion. This usually points to a worn gearbox or a blocked movement path. Disassemble the mechanism according to the service manual, clear any debris, and lubricate gears with a non‑conductive oil.

5. Update Firmware and Reset Settings

Outdated firmware can cause erratic behavior. Connect the unit to a computer via the provided USB port, download the latest firmware from the manufacturer’s site, and follow the flashing instructions. After the update, perform a factory reset to clear lingering configuration glitches.

Preventive Maintenance Tips

Keeping the KBLN165H in peak condition requires a regular care routine. A few minutes each month can stave off most failures.

  • Dust Management – Use a soft brush or low‑speed compressed air to clear vents and fan blades. Accumulated dust reduces cooling efficiency and can lead to thermal shutdowns.
  • Connector Care – Apply a thin layer of dielectric grease to critical connectors; this prevents oxidation and maintains reliable contact.
  • Lubrication Schedule – For moving parts, re‑apply lubricant every six months or after heavy use. Over‑lubricating can attract dust, so wipe excess away.
  • Firmware Checks – Set a calendar reminder to check for updates quarterly. Even minor patches can improve stability and add new diagnostic features.

Document each maintenance session in a simple log. Recording dates, actions taken, and observed performance helps track wear patterns and can be invaluable when consulting a service technician.

When to Call a Professional Service

Some issues are best left to trained experts, especially when they involve high‑voltage components or intricate calibration. Consider professional help if you encounter any of the following:

  • Repeated power‑rail failures after multiple replacements.
  • Persistent signal distortion despite clean connectors and firmware updates.
  • Complex calibration errors that affect output accuracy.
  • Physical damage to the PCB, such as cracked traces or burnt components.

Choosing a certified technician ensures that any replacement parts meet the original specifications, preserving the warranty and overall reliability of the KBLN165H.

Frequently Asked Questions

Q: How often should I replace the power supply on a KBLN165H?

A: If you notice frequent flickering or intermittent power loss, replace the supply after three to five years of use, or sooner if voltage tests show abnormal readings.

Q: Can I use third‑party firmware on the KBLN165H?

A: It’s generally not recommended. Unofficial firmware may void the warranty and could introduce incompatibilities that lead to instability.

Q: What’s the best way to clean stubborn grime from the fan blades?

A: Dampen a microfiber cloth with isopropyl alcohol (70 % concentration) and gently wipe each blade. Avoid soaking the motor housing to prevent moisture intrusion.

Q: Is it safe to operate the KBLN165H in a high‑humidity environment?

A: The unit is rated for up to 60 % relative humidity. For higher levels, use a dehumidifier or sealed enclosure to avoid condensation on internal components.
